Game Overview
Demons Forge is the kind of MS-DOS dungeon crawler that makes you question whether you're actually having fun or just torturing yourself—in the best way possible. You start in some dingy ruins, armed with nothing but a sword and a prayer, and within minutes, you're getting jumped by pixelated horrors from the shadows. No tutorials, no mercy—just pure '90s RPG vibes.
The combat's clunky by today's standards, but there's something weirdly satisfying about landing a hit and watching those chunky sprites explode into gore. And the deeper you go, the more the game messes with you—secret doors, traps that feel personal, and loot that might just save your life or get you killed faster. If you ever spent weekends mapping dungeons on graph paper, this one’s like slipping into a familiar, slightly cursed glove.
Fair warning: the sound design sticks with you. Those monster noises? They’ll haunt your dreams.
